Variant summary

Our verdict is Uncertain significance. Variant got 4 ACMG points: 4P and 0B. PM2PP3_Moderate

The NM_001146685.2(TMEM88B):​c.179T>C​(p.Leu60Pro)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000523 in 1,339,530 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.179T>C (p.L60P) alteration is located in exon 1 (coding exon 1) of the TMEM88B gene. This alteration results from a T to C substitution at nucleotide position 179, causing the leucine (L) at amino acid position 60 to be replaced by a proline (P).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
